Marinated dishes are flavorful dishes that kids really love. The marinating process creates flavorful dishes through the seamless blend of natural food flavors and spices that are combined during the procedure. Aside from adding flavor to your dishes it also helps in tenderizing tough meat like those that are usually found in pork and beef cuts. Marinated grilled dishes go well with sidings or toppings that are cold, fresh and equally flavorful. A good example of this is the combination of Grilled Porkchop and Mango Salsa which is a favorite fare for our backyard dining activities.
Here is our recipe for Grilled Porckchop with Mango Salsa.
Steps and Ingredients for Grilled Porkchop:
4 pcs Porkchop
1 clove garlic minced
2 tbsps soy sauce
3-4 pcs calamansi
ground pepper
1. Prepare soymansi marinade by combining garlic, soysauce, calamansi and ground pepper.
2. Marinade porkchop in soymansi mixture at least 30 minutes before grilling.
3. Grill porkchop using moderate heat and serve with mango salsa.
Steps and Ingredients for Mango Salsa:
1 small ripe mango, peeled, pitted and diced
4 scallions, trimmed and finely sliced
2 ripe tomatoes seeded and chopped
1 tsp muscovado sugar
2 tbsp chopped fresh cilantro
1. Combine all Mango Salsa ingredients in a bowl.
2. Gently toss and refrigerate.
3. Serve with grilled porkchop when ready. Mango Salsa should also be prepared and refrigerated at least 30 minutes before serving to allow the flavors to develop.
